## Description

CoreWeave seeks a Senior Associate, Energy Markets to support the evaluation, structuring, and execution of power solutions that enable its rapidly growing data center platform.

The Senior Associate will play a critical role in assessing powered land and power access opportunities, supporting deal evaluation and contract execution, and coordinating closely with cross-functional teams to ensure power solutions align with CoreWeave’s technical, operational, and financial requirements.

### Core Responsibilities:

#### Deal Evaluation & Financial Analysis

- Lead detailed financial analysis and modeling for power and energy-related opportunities, including powered land, utility power access, and third-party power solutions.

- Evaluate economics of power supply options, including utility service, self-build, and alternative or emerging power technologies.

- Develop scenario analyses around pricing, timing, capacity, and risk to support investment decisions.

- Prepare clear, data-driven investment memos, presentations, and materials for internal review by senior leadership.

#### Power & Energy Strategy

- Assess power availability, interconnection paths, timelines, and constraints for new and existing data center markets.

- Support evaluation of new power technologies and their applicability to CoreWeave’s load profile.

- Partner with internal teams to align power strategy with deployment schedules and long-term growth plans.

#### Cross-Functional Collaboration (CoreWeave-Focused)

- Work closely with Data Center Operations, Construction & Design, Corporate Finance, and Treasury to evaluate tradeoffs across cost, schedule, technical feasibility, and risk.

- Translate technical and market inputs into financial and commercial implications to support decision-making.

- Serve as a connective layer between technical, operational, and financial teams throughout deal lifecycle.

#### External Engagement & Contract Support

- Support engagement with utilities, power developers, and infrastructure partners to evaluate solutions and advance deals.

- Assist in structuring, reviewing, and executing commercial agreements, including Energy Supply Agreements and Capacity Service Agreements.

- Coordinate with Legal, Finance, and internal stakeholders through diligence, contract execution, and post-signing handoff.
